Alabama Statutes
§ 34-13-111 — License Required; Inspections; Transfer of License; Change of Ownership
Alabama·Title 34 Professions and Businesses·Ch. 13 Funeral Services·Art. 3 Licenses, Examinations, and Registration·Div. 4 Funeral Establishments
(a)No funeral establishment or branch thereof for the preparation, disposition, and care of dead human bodies shall be opened or maintained unless licensed by the board. No funeral establishment or branch shall be moved without obtaining a new funeral establishment license from the board.
(b)Every funeral service, memorial service, or committal service, or part thereof, that is conducted in Alabama, for hire or for profit, shall be in the actual charge and shall be under the direct supervision of a funeral director who is licensed by the board, unless otherwise provided for in this chapter or by rule of the board.
